INSTRUCTIONS FOR THE ENVIRONMENT
This product may contain substances that can be harmful to the
environment and to the human health, if not disposed of properly. We
therefore provide you the following information in order to prevent
the release of such substances and to optimize use of natural
resources. The electrical and electronic products should not be
disposed of in the normal household waste, but should be properly
collected in order to be correctly treated. The symbol of the crossed
bin shown on the product and in this page reminds the need to properly dispose of the
product at the end of its life. In this way you can avoid that a non-specific treatment of the
substances contained in these products, or an improper use of parts of them can lead to
harmful consequences for the environment and human health. Moreover, you can
contribute to the recovery, recycling and reuse of many of the materials composing these
products. This is why the manufacturers and distributors of Electrical and Electronic
Equipment (EEE) organize proper collection and disposal of the equipment themselves. At
the end of the product’s lifespan, please contact your dealer for instructions regarding
disposal. When purchasing this product your distributor will inform you of the possibility
to replace your old device with a new one, on condition that the type of product and its
functions are the same. If the dimensions are not over 25 cm, the EEE can be returned
without any equivalent product purchase obligation. Disposal of the product in any other
way will be liable to the penalties foreseen by the laws in force in the country where the
product is disposed of. Moreover, we suggest adoption of the following measures to
protect the environment: recycling the inner and outer packaging supplied with the
product and disposing of used batteries (if contained in the product) correctly.
With your help, we can reduce the amount of natural resources used in the manufacture
of EEE, minimize use of landfills for product disposal and improve quality of life by
preventing the release into the environment of potentially dangerous substances.
INSTALLING AND REPLACING BATTERIES
The product contains a battery that could be replaced during the
lifetime of the product itself. Dispose of the battery contained in the
product correctly at the end of their useful lifespan (thus when it can
no longer be charged) by placing it in appropriate battery disposal
container separate from generic unsorted waste. Collection and
recycling of batteries helps protect the environment and preserve natural resources,
allowing recovery of valuable materials.

WARRANTY VALIDITY
•One year if the product is purchased by a natural or legal person who uses it in
business as an entrepreneur, sales representative, craftsman or professional or his/her
intermediary.
•Two years if the product is purchased by a consumer or user (the natural person who
does not use it in business as an entrepreneur, sales representative, craftsman or
professional).
•Six month on the battery, regardless of the occupation of the product purchaser.
•The warranty covers factory or material defects.
•Product support and warranty: visit the website www.nilox.com
WARRANTY RESTRICTIONS
The warranty is null and void in the following cases:
•No proof of purchase (invoice or receipt).
•Tampering with and forcing parts.
•Other defects due to: inappropriate use, unauthorized changes, operations not in
accordance with technical product specifications; incorrect maintenance; defects due
to use of any element not designed to be used with the product; technical work
performed by unauthorized personnel.
The above refers to consumer goods warranty principles pursuant to Directive
1999/44/EC.

PRECAUTIONS FOR USE
•Users are held responsible for checking in advance what safety rules apply in
the country where they intend to use the DOC AIR. DOC AIR use may be
prohibited in public areas or in areas subject to traffic regulations.
•Avoid use on gravel, sand, grass, slippery or wet surfaces. DOC AIR was
designed to be used on smooth and dry surfaces.
•Never drive near cliffs or precipices. DOC AIR was not designed to be driven in
these contexts. The retailer, distributor, importer and manufacturer cannot be
held liable for driver injuries or DOC AIR and/or third party damages caused by
this type of conduct.
•Never drive DOC AIR with several people on the board, this could cause you to
lose control of the vehicle.
•Never let unattended children near DOC AIR since this could be a hazard.
•Familiarise yourself with DOC AIR use and make sure all stops are tight before
use.
•Do not store the batteries near heat sources, they could explode.
•Do not leave the charger in damp or wet places and do not use it if damaged.
Routinely check the cable, plug and external casing. If damaged, it should not
be used until repaired.
•Never use DOC AIR if not in perfect conditions.
•Never use DOC AIR if you are not in perfect psycho-physical conditions. People
who suffer from physical or mental disabilities should not, or should be
prevented from using DOC AIR.
•We recommend you to push DOC AIR at start to reduce the load. This will
lengthen the DOC AIR working life.
•DOC AIR is not a toy.

5
EN
•DOC AIR uses electricity and requires a transformer.
•Warning: electrical shock risks may arise using the transformer.
•We highly discourage use by anyone who cannot comfortably stand on it.
•Always learn and observe local laws and regulations applicable where the DOC
AIR is used.
•Always keep away from car and engine powered vehicle traffic and only use
DOC AIR where permitted and cautiously.
•Wet, slippery, cracked, irregular or rough surfaces can reduce traction and
increase the risk of accidents.
•Be careful of potential obstacles that could get caught in the wheels or force
you to suddenly swerve or lose control.
•Do not drive in the rain or when the outdoor temperature risks freezing
surfaces.
•Never submerge DOC AIR in water since electrical and drive components could
be damaged by water or generate hazardous conditions.

ASSEMBLY
START-UP
Rest DOC AIR on the ground and press
the board lock/release button with
your foot.
Raise the front of DOC AIR until you
hear the lock click in place.
CAREFULLY CHECK THAT THE
RETAINER IS IN THE UPPER
POSITION, AS SHOWN IN THE
FIGURE.
Raise the handlebar pole to suit your
height.
Finally, assembly the handles, as shown in the
figure.

USE
The “thinking” part of your DOC AIR is concentrated in the handlebar.
Next to the handles you will find:
•the accelerator on the right
•the electronic brake on the left
•the multi-purpose button in the middle.
POWER ON AND OFF
To turn DOC AIR on, gently press the multi-purpose button in the centre of the
handlebars, and hold it down for about 2 seconds. The button will light up in purple and
then turn green.
Press the button and hold it down again to turn it off.
